Arrest made after firearms incident in Tokoroa

Police have arrested a man after a firearms incident in Tokoroa last week.

Police were called to an address on Baberton St around 11.15pm on February 17, and found a seriously injured man.

The man was taken to Waikato Hospital.

He has since been released.

A 25-year-old man has been arrested and is expected to appear in Rotorua District Court tomorrow, facing charges of unlawful possession of a firearm and wounding with intent to cause grievous bodily harm.
